A MAGNIFICENT AND SUPERBLY CARVED ARCHAISTIC RHINOCEROS HORN ' CHILONG ' LIBATION CUP
A MAGNIFICENT AND SUPERBLY CARVED ARCHAISTIC RHINOCEROS HORN ' CHILONG ' LIBATION CUP QIANLONG PERIOD (1736-1795) The spectacularly large, well-proportioned cup fashioned from a single piece of rhinoceros horn, the tapering body with a wide pinched pouring lip, exquisitely carved with keyfret borders contouring the inner and outer rim, the waisted mid-section and foot meticulously detailed in thread relief with bands of taotie masks divided by shallow, notched flanges, carved all over in high relief with thirty-nine lively chilong clambering around the sides and over into the interior, the curved strap-handle with large tiger head terminal, the whole raised on a high slightly flared foot, the material of lustrous golden amber tone darkening slightly at the core 8 3/8 in. (21.2 cm.) across, wood stand, box Weight: 22.2 oz. (630 gm.)
